Northbound Coquihalla Highway Closed Between Hope and Merritt After Vehicle Crash

On June 15, 2026, a section of the Coquihalla Highway in British Columbia was closed to northbound traffic following a vehicle crash. The incident occurred between exits 250 and 276, affecting travel between the communities of Hope and Merritt.
Traffic Impact and Response
According to DriveBC, the northbound lane is expected to remain closed for several hours. As of 9 a.m. PT, there was no estimated time for the highway to reopen. However, the southbound side remains operational, though travelers should anticipate delays due to emergency vehicles responding to the scene.
